Ajax Leak Repair & Metal Roof

Project Details:

  • Location: Barrett Cres, Ajax

  • Duration: 3 days

  • Roof Area: 980 sq. ft.

  • Material: ThyssenKrupp 26-gauge G90 galvanized steel

  • Design: Monterey Metal Tile

  • Color: Red

  • Cost: 6,000-7,500 CAD

Project Overview

This Ajax project began with a hidden issue. The homeowner had dealt with leaks in the past, and during our inspection we found that some of the plywood underneath had been damaged because of it.Before moving forward with the metal roof installation, we removed the affected section, replaced it with new plywood, sealed it with a Strotex Dynamic membrane, and then completed the roofing system using our double wood strapping technology. At MROOF, we never install metal panels over exposed wood - there must always be a protective layer in place.

Project Challenges 

The main challenge was addressing structural damage caused by past leaks. Some of the plywood had weakened and could not be left as is. Installing a new roof over compromised wood is never an option. The repair had to be done properly first, and the surface needed to be fully sealed before moving forward. Proper preparation is what determines how long a roof truly lasts.

Installation Process

Stage 2: Membrane Protection & Double Wood Strapping

Once the new plywood was in place, we sealed the area with a Strotex Dynamic membrane to provide an additional layer of protection. At MROOF, we always make sure there is at least one protective layer beneath the metal panels — either existing shingles or a membrane. We then installed our double wood strapping system, creating proper ventilation and a secure base for the metal roof.

Stage 1: Plywood Replacement

One of the things that we noticed during our inspection was that there was a part of the plywood that had been damaged by leaks in the past and could not be left there. We therefore removed the damaged part and replaced it with new plywood.

Stage 3: Metal Panels Installation

After the roof had been properly repaired and protected, we began installing the metal panels. The panels were carefully placed to ensure that they were straight and clean. Since the foundation had been properly prepared, the metal roof installation now has a foundation that will support it for many years to come.

Stage 4: Final Touches

To complete the project, we finished all detailing, secured ridge components, and sealed key transition areas to ensure the roof was fully weather-tight. Every connection was checked to make sure the system not only looked clean but was built to last.
